METIS @ Kuta, Bali

Located in the off beaten part of Kuta, the journey here from Uluwatu Temples was dreadful - 1.5 hours in total with a jam to boot and of course, a road friendly driver like mine who would not for the living daylights of himself go beyond 50km/hr is beyond me.

Chef Nicolas 'Doudou' Tourneville, formerly of Kafe Warisan , brings his legendary talent and culinary artistry to the table with a masterful combination of French Mediterranean cuisine. Filled with mainly westerners, before we quickly brush it aside as a tourist trap, let me walk you through my experience.

Requests for warm water were bluntly rejected with "sparkling or still." Our 1.5L Evian (IDR 55,000) could only last beyond 8 glasses.

bread

The bread basket of breadsticks and rolls were enough for us to go through at least three rounds each, filling us up considerably.

soup

Lobster Bisque, Crab Tortellini (IDR 98,000)

Flavourful soup with mild touches of seafood, the crab tortellini was however forgettable.

Pan Seared King Prawns, Baby Potatoes, Shimeji Mushroom, Green Asparagus, Light Coconut Tomato and Basil Sauce (IDR 175,000)

These crunchy bulbs were actually quite good with the tangy sauce. It would go perfectly with rice. 

seafood pasta

Lobster and Seafood Linguini, Saffron Chives Velouté (IDR 189,000)

Noodles cooked al dente and tossed in a beautiful broth and seafood slivers. It was fishy at some parts but otherwise, an okay pasta dish.

duck confit

Duck Leg Confit, Mushroom Saute Potatoes, Curly Endive Salad, Black Pepper Sauce (IDR 185,000)

A tad salty but then again hardly are duck confits not this over marinated. The portion of mushroom sauteed potatoes were decently portioned as a side on its own. It was only after dinner that we realised how much MSG went into it.

steak

"L'Entrecost" 200 days Australian Black Angus Ribeye (IDR 295,000)

A really decent cut at 250 grams for the price paid. Every bite was succulent with a lovely shade of pink.

There weekday lunch sets are really affordable at

Two courses at IDR 90,000++
Three courses at IDR 120,000++

It is catered for the foreigners - those with a lifestyle to maintain. Ambience check, food checked and prices checked, I would not be raring to return but it was a pleasant visit nonetheless.
